The Treasury Management Officer (TMO) III is an independent senior advisor who is accountable to develop new Treasury Management (TM) business and expand TM relationships. Possesses a proven track record of growing revenue through portfolio fee expansion and new sales. They are a critical thinker who is orientated toward creating detailed business plans to facilitate the attainment of goals. A skilled negotiator possessing the business acumen to balance customer orientation with productive results. As a skilled communicator and presenter, the TMO III will seek public opportunities to represent the Treasury Management business and TD Bank in strategic settings.

**Depth & Scope**:

- Builds and maintains productive and collaborative relationships with the Relationship Managers and other channel sales partners
- Serves as the trusted advisor for clients with cash management needs to develop, manage and retain profitable customer relationships
- Independently creates and executes a sales and marketing strategy that achieves established market penetration, cross-sell, revenue and customer acquisition goals
- Advances the TD Treasury Management brand by using industry expertise, conducting in-market customer and prospect presentations, seminars, lunch & learns, etc
- Expands and retains business customers by identifying needs and challenging customers with insights
- Demonstrates independent ability to lead the prospecting effort and coordinate a deal team to pursue opportunities
- Partners with Relationship Managers in performing strategic dialogs to turn prospects into clients
- Leads or participates in relationship management by identifying customer needs, provide solutions, make in-person customer calls
- Advises Relationship Managers on fee revenue decisions
- Manages portfolio to deepen existing relationships through proactive identification of solutions to meet customer needs. Partner with Relationship Manager's in identifying opportunities for clients and prospects
- Builds and maintains strong networks with Centers of Influence (COI's)
- Collaborates with Relationship Managers on customer relationships to ensure unified approach to meeting customer Banking needs
- Partners with Sales Associate to deliver comprehensive recommendations based on customer cash management needs, relationship reviews and leadership to provide an excellent customer experience
- Ensures customers and internal partners are leveraging the proper cash management functions: Treasury Management Solutions, Service and Implementation and partner appropriately with Sales Associates
- Records accurately sales activities such as pipeline opportunities, calls, and customer notes in Salesforce
- Follows procedural guidelines to leverage Implementation team to ensuring superior on-boarding and excellent client experience
- Accountable for document origination and execution for Master Cash Management Agreement, Product(s) and Customer Due Diligence
- Represents the organization at various industry conferences, regional events, regional business meetings, in-market functions, and with regional centers of influence both internally and externally
- Adheres to all Risk policies and procedures
- Possesses financial acumen and provide relationship revenue advice to Relationship Managers
- Navigates the bank to deliver relationship revenue and an excellent customer experience
